General Information about Ultramarine

Ultramarine, represented by the hexadecimal color code #1914A0, is a deep and intense shade of blue. Historically, the pigment ultramarine was derived from the gemstone lapis lazuli, making it a highly prized and expensive color, often associated with royalty and religious figures. In modern color theory, ultramarine is considered a cool color, capable of evoking feelings of calmness, stability, and intelligence. It finds application across various fields, including art, design, and technology. Its intense saturation makes it a popular choice for creating visually striking designs. Because of its richness, however, it should be used judiciously, balancing it with neutral or lighter colors to avoid overwhelming the viewer. Ultramarine is a blue that carries both historical significance and aesthetic appeal.

The color #1914A0, also known as Ultramarine, presents some accessibility challenges, particularly regarding color contrast. When used as a foreground color for text, it's crucial to ensure sufficient contrast against the background. A light background is generally necessary to meet W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) standards for readability. Tools like contrast checkers can verify compliance. Avoid pairing Ultramarine with dark or similarly saturated colors, as this can strain the eye and reduce comprehension. Consider providing alternative color schemes for users with visual impairments or color blindness. Using Ultramarine for purely decorative elements poses less of an accessibility concern, but always prioritize a user-friendly experience by considering the overall visual harmony and potential impact on users with sensitivities.
